Calculate your transit time
Your airport journey can begin 24 hours earlier than departure when you could register, pay charges for checked baggage that can speed up the dropping of luggage and join textual content notifications to maintain up with planning.
Then decide when you must go away for the airport. The thumb rule is to reach two hours earlier than departure for home flights (three for worldwide), which permits your self sufficient time to verify baggage, undergo safety (particularly in the event you don’t have an accelerated clearance) and board.
“The largest problem at airports is the volatility of how lengthy it could actually take to get there and get from the curb to the gate,” says Gary Leff, creator of the Aviation Weblog WingS
Use a card app to get a journey time to airport every week or a number of days earlier than departure. The airline web sites often embody safety occasions.
If you’re checking a bag, chances are you’ll have to do it a minimum of 45 minutes earlier than dwelling deviations (verify your service for interruption occasions). Add this to your transit time, together with a snug pillow.
Elevated safety authorization
The quickest method by way of safety is to register for accelerated permission.
Vacationers enrolled in Tsa precheck Often, wait 10 minutes or much less safety, in accordance with the Transport Safety Administration. Membership, which prices between $ 76.75 and $ 85, relying on the report supplier, is nice for 5 years.
Global entryWho accelerates vacationers by way of customs screening after they return to america, entails enrolling in TSA Precheck. It prices $ 120 and is nice for 5 years.
Clearly Permits members to make use of their strips at 59 airports throughout the nation to achieve the entrance of safety traces ($ 199 a yr).

Convey your individual meals
Airports are identified for prime meals costs. A sandwich that may price $ 5 in a grocery retailer can simply transfer twice, which on the airport.
So put on your individual dishes and snacks. Simply ensure They can clear security (For instance, yogurt is taken into account liquid and containers over three ounces may be confiscated). Additionally, convey an empty bottle of water to cost after clearing the safety.
If you cannot byo, Harriet Bascas, a Seattle -based creator who writes a visit weblog Stuck at the airportRecommends browsing meals courts and ordering of appetizers or parts of youngsters to cut back prices.
Wrap your electrical wants
Many airports have tremendously expanded the provision {of electrical} retailers to cost units. However recruiting an individual may be aggressive, and generally shops don’t work.
“I used to be ridiculously working as I believed that my laptop computer or telephone was solely charging to search out that the entire financial institution of chairs was off,” stated Gia Bascas. “I realized to verify first earlier than I settled.”
She recommends taking a variety of cable so you may share a plug with different passengers.
Take a look at the issue with your individual Outer batteryS George Hobbika, which based the flight search engine AirfarewatchdogIt accepts one highly effective sufficient to cost a number of units directly.

Be your individual rewriting agent
When the flight is delayed or canceled, passengers inevitably start to rearrange to speak to the gate agent. However are available in when you wait. With the administration of the airline; You’ll be able to often get data extra effectively.
“Often, clients may have the identical entry to locations within the app because the desk brokers can see,” Sumers stated.
With storms or cascading delays, the presence of seats may be liquid.
“If you’re vigilant within the app, you’ll find locations that haven’t been obtainable only one minute earlier than,” added Mr. Sumers.
